About the Pub
The Central is a small but cosy pub with a friendly group of locals, now even cosier due to the real fire. This is a great pub to watch the races from as you can't get much closer to the course. It is rumoured that the Central is favoured by many as the last port of call on a tour of Ramsey due to its location in the town and its flexible closing times.After closing due to flooding in December 2015,The Central fully reopened mid March 2016.

"The Central Hotel in Parliament Square was formerly the High Baliff's residence. It was opened as a public house on May 13th 1889 by Jimmy Purcell. Its exterior has hardly changed since. At one tiem, the smoke-room bar was a replica of a Manx Kitchen."
Source: Manx Inns by Suzanne Cubbon
